Prime Minister holds talks in Iran
22.11.2022
Belarus and Iran have both faced illegitimate sanctions and economic pressure from the West. This was declared by Prime Minister Roman Golovchenko at his meeting with the First Vice President of the Islamic republic. The Belarusian governmental delegation is on an official visit in Tehran. The dialog began with the greeting ceremony, then a substantive talk on cooperation was held. The negotiations started in a narrow format and continued in an extended one. It was noted, that it is necessary to increase the trade turnover in the present conditions.
